How to: Make Jewellery from Lord of the Rings
Emily Tan writes: The only movie collectibles I'm ever truly tempted by are the replicas of jewellery worn in the show. And of all movie-themed jewellery out there, there is none I covet more than the bling from LOTR. So imagine my delight when I came across this amazing database on crafting LOTR costumes, jewellery included. Although some of the tutes (especially regarding the headpieces) are terribly advanced, quite a few are quick, easy, and produce remarkably lovely results.
Read on for a quick list of the various tutes on the site.
- No LOTR costume is complete without the elven leaf brooch pinned around somewhere. Learn how to fashion detailed replicas from clay, or quicker and easier versions.
- These fantastically detailed tutes on how to craft Arwen's and Galadriel's headpieces may be too advanced for most. But you can still gaze in awe at the incredible talent of the crafters.
- Quick and easy tutes on making Eowyn's Gold Medallion Necklace and of course, the Evenstar.
- Even less prominent jewellery is replicated by the amazing crafters on this site - like Arwen's belt buckle!
